Web18 ago 2024 · http://www.njcourts.gov/forms/12772_tips_virtual_hearing.pdf WebChief Justice Stuart Rabner today designated Superior Court Judge Thomas W. Sumners Jr. as the chief judge of the Appellate Division, effective May 23. Judge Sumners succeeds Chief Judge Carmen Messano, who retires after more than 25 years on the bench, including 10 years as the chief judge. Find records for closed … Web13 giu 2024 · Low-income tenants are protected from being displaced from their homes if they missed rent between March 2024 and Dec. 31, 2024 and filed a form with the state. Under normal circumstances, a landlord can file for eviction the day after his tenant misses a payment. But a pandemic-era state law allows eligible renters to fill out a certification ...
